Assistant Teacher, Child Development Center

The George Mason University Child Development Center (CDC) invites applications for 3 experienced, dedicated and progressively minded individuals to serve as Assistant Teacher in a Preschool or Twos classroom. These are full-time, year-round positions with excellent benefits. George Mason University has a strong institutional commitment to the achievement of excellence and diversity among its faculty and staff, and strongly encourages candidates to apply who will enrich Mason's academic and culturally inclusive environment.

Responsibilities:


  • Support an emergent play-based curriculum in partnership with an experienced Lead Teacher to foster children's overall development and social-emotional skills based on the individual needs and interests of each child;
  • Effectively engage with program team while supporting one lead teacher, and collaborating with classroom assistant teachers, volunteers, and other staff;
  • Help implement developmentally appropriate, child-centered curriculum consistent with the CDC's mission and philosophy in emergent, open-ended play emphasizing emotional support and respect for each child;
  • Maintain all standards of training and education as required by the Virginia Department of Social Services (VDSS), Virginia Department of Education (VDOE) and National Association for the Education of Young Children (NAEYC);
  • Develop and maintain strong connections with families;
  • Follow basic principles of early childhood development as defined in the NAEYC code of ethical conduct.


Required Qualifications:

  • Completed coursework in ECE, child development, or ECE special education, or equivalent of 1 to 2 years experience in early childhood/early elementary setting;
  • The successful candidate must pass a tuberculosis (TB) screening and criminal record clearance before employment;
  • CPR and First Aid certifications are required, but may be completed after employment;
  • Effective communication (both written and verbal) and some supervisory skills are preferred.


Preferred Qualifications:


  • Minimum CDA or equivalent 12 college credits in ECE or child development;
  • Demonstrated experience with children birth to age 5;
  • Demonstrated experience with dual and multilingual children, as well as experience working with children and families from diverse backgrounds.
